    Hi,

    Sorry but I am unable to comprehend 'saved state'.

    Does this mean 'saving it for a session' (in sessionStorage may be)
    or
    introducing required number of config options (and these options value will be set every time the 'angular' links are changed to 'direct' or vice versa through designer) ?

     
    • Isaac Bennetch

      Isaac Bennetch - 2015-06-13

      This is an interesting question because most of the rest of the information about Designer display is stored in the phpMyAdmin Configuration Storage, for instance $cfg['Servers'][$i]['table_coords'] and $cfg['Servers'][$i]['pdf_pages'].

      I wonder if we could implement some way of storing this in the phpMyAdmin Configuration Storage.

      "Saved state" preferably means remembering it forever across sessions, but sessionStorage might be acceptable as well. I think we can ask on -devel for some assistance with brainstorming about this.
